Job Summary
Supervise the back office medical assistant staff and oversee patient flow while performing patient care activities including taking vital signs, drawing blood, administering medications, and assisting with exams. Interview and exit patients, completing consent forms, checking charts for errors, and counseling individuals on program services. Perform phlebotomy, injections, vitals, and process lab specimens per protocol, while maintaining and stocking the dispensary and exam rooms. Handle front office duties such as answering phones, scheduling, chart retrieval, and checking in patients. Route patients and charts to maintain clinic flow and ensure strict adherence to policy and procedure manuals. This role requires six-month supervisory experience, bi-lingual Spanish/English skills, and the ability to work in a fast-paced, OSHA Category 1 environment.
